Odisha govt cancels UG and PG exams

Odisha govt

In the wake of Coronavirus outbreak, the Odisha Higher Education Department has decided to cancel the theory and practical tests of the end semester examinations for the Undergraduate and Postgraduate courses.

According to reports, meetings were conducted by the Higher Education Minister Arun Kumar Sahoo along with the Vice-Chancellors of the state public universities and principles of autonomous colleges.

The decision not to conduct the end-semester exams will be implemented by all the universities and autonomous colleges under the jurisdiction of the department.

The state government had earlier decided to conduct the sixth-semester examinations for the undergraduate courses to be held between June 20 and July 24, 2020. The results of these examinations will be declared by August 31, 2020. The Final year PG Examinations will be completed by August 20, 2020, and the results will be declared by September 20, 2020.

The state government has taken such a decision with regard to the ongoing COVID-19 lockdown in the country. Students from different universities had earlier on protested against the decision of the state government for conducting the offline examinations of the Undergraduate and postgraduate courses between June and August 2020.

The students will be marked based on the internal marks along with the mars obtained in the previous semester in the subjects.
